What Is a Crypto Exchange?
What is a crypto exchange? A crypto exchange is a platform that allows people to buy, sell, trade, and sometimes store cryptocurrencies such as Bitcoin, Ethereum, and stablecoins. Some exchanges operate through a centralized company, while others use blockchain-based smart contracts to let users trade directly from their wallets.
Crypto exchanges have become one of the main entry points into the cryptocurrency market.
If you want to buy Bitcoin with traditional money, swap one cryptocurrency for another, or sell crypto for cash, you will often use an exchange.
However, not all exchanges work in the same way.
The two major categories are centralized exchanges (CEXs) and decentralized exchanges (DEXs).
Understanding the difference can help you choose the right platform and avoid common mistakes.
How Does a Crypto Exchange Work?
At a basic level, an exchange connects people who want to buy cryptocurrencies with people who want to sell them.
Imagine that Alice wants to buy Bitcoin.
Bob wants to sell Bitcoin.
An exchange can help match their orders.
The exchange records the transaction and updates the users’ balances.
However, the process depends on the type of exchange.
A centralized exchange usually manages the trading system itself.
A decentralized exchange uses blockchain-based smart contracts to facilitate trades.
This difference affects how users deposit funds, execute trades, and maintain control of their assets.
What Is a Centralized Exchange?
A centralized exchange, often called a CEX, is operated by a company or organization.
The company manages the platform and provides the infrastructure needed for users to trade cryptocurrencies.
Examples of services commonly offered by centralized exchanges include:
- Cryptocurrency trading.
- Buying crypto with fiat currency.
- Selling cryptocurrency.
- Deposits and withdrawals.
- Spot trading.
- Advanced trading tools.
- Price charts.
- Account management.
- Sometimes lending or staking services.
Users normally create an account before trading.
The exchange then maintains an internal record of the user’s assets and transactions.
How Does a Centralized Exchange Hold Your Crypto?
When you deposit cryptocurrency into a centralized exchange, the exchange generally controls the blockchain addresses holding those assets.
The exchange then credits your account with the corresponding balance.
For example, suppose you deposit 0.1 BTC.
The exchange may receive the Bitcoin on its blockchain address and show 0.1 BTC in your exchange account.
You don’t necessarily control the private keys associated with the exchange’s wallet.
This creates an important distinction:
Having a balance on an exchange is not the same as holding cryptocurrency in a self-custody wallet.
With self-custody, you control the private keys.
With a centralized exchange, the platform generally controls the keys for the assets it holds on your behalf.
What Is a Decentralized Exchange?
A decentralized exchange, or DEX, allows users to trade cryptocurrencies through blockchain-based smart contracts.
Instead of depositing your assets into a company-controlled account, you generally connect a compatible wallet.
The smart contracts then facilitate the trade.
For example, you might connect your Ethereum wallet to a DEX and swap ETH for an ERC-20 token.
The resulting tokens can be sent directly to your wallet.
This means you generally maintain control of your assets throughout the process.

What Is an Order Book?
Many centralized exchanges use an order book.
An order book is a list of buy and sell orders submitted by traders.
For example, buyers might submit offers such as:
- Buy 0.1 BTC at $100,000.
- Buy 0.2 BTC at $99,900.
- Buy 0.5 BTC at $99,500.
Sellers might submit:
- Sell 0.1 BTC at $100,100.
- Sell 0.3 BTC at $100,200.
- Sell 0.5 BTC at $100,500.
When compatible buy and sell orders meet, the exchange can execute the trade.
What Is a Market Order?
A market order instructs an exchange to buy or sell an asset at the best available prices in the market.
For example, if you submit a market order to buy Bitcoin, the exchange attempts to execute the purchase using available sell orders.
Market orders are generally designed for speed rather than a specific price.
However, the final price can differ from what you expected, especially in markets with low liquidity.
What Is a Limit Order?
A limit order lets you specify the price at which you’re willing to buy or sell.
For example:
You might tell an exchange:
Buy Bitcoin only if the price reaches $95,000.
If the market reaches that price and enough sellers are available, the order may execute.
If the price never reaches your limit, the order may remain open or expire depending on the platform.
Limit orders give traders more control over price, but they don’t guarantee execution.
What Is a Trading Pair?
A trading pair shows the two assets being exchanged.
For example:
BTC/USDT
This means Bitcoin is being traded against USDT.
Another example is:
ETH/USDC
This means Ethereum is being traded against USDC.
The first asset is usually called the base asset.
The second is the quote asset.
If ETH/USDC is trading at $3,000, that means one ETH is currently priced at approximately 3,000 USDC.
What Are Exchange Trading Fees?
Crypto exchanges usually charge fees for certain activities.
Common fees include:
- Trading fees.
- Withdrawal fees.
- Deposit fees.
- Network-related charges.
- Other service fees.
Trading fees can vary depending on the exchange and the user’s trading volume.
Some platforms use a maker-taker fee model.
A maker adds liquidity to the order book.
A taker removes liquidity by executing against an existing order.
The exact definitions and fee schedules vary between exchanges.
What Is Slippage?
Slippage occurs when the price you expected for a trade differs from the price at which the trade actually executes.
This can happen when:
- The market moves quickly.
- Liquidity is low.
- The order is large.
- A DEX has limited liquidity.
For example, you might expect to buy an asset at $100, but the final average price could be slightly higher.
Large trades in low-liquidity markets can experience greater slippage.
Why Does Liquidity Matter?
Liquidity refers to how easily an asset can be bought or sold without causing a major change in its price.
A highly liquid market generally has many buyers and sellers.
A low-liquidity market has fewer participants.
Imagine you want to sell $1,000 worth of a cryptocurrency.
If thousands of dollars of buy orders are available close to the current market price, the transaction may execute with relatively little price impact.
If only a small amount of liquidity exists, your trade could move the market significantly.
Therefore, liquidity is an important factor when evaluating an exchange or trading pair.

How Does a Centralized Exchange Match Trades?
When you place a trade on a centralized exchange, the platform needs to match your order with another trader.
This is usually handled through an order-matching engine.
Suppose you want to buy 0.01 BTC.
Another trader wants to sell 0.01 BTC at a price you’re willing to pay.
The exchange’s matching engine can connect those orders.
Once the trade executes, the exchange updates the balances of both users.
Importantly, this doesn’t necessarily mean that Bitcoin immediately moves between two personal blockchain wallets.
Instead, the exchange can update its internal records.
The actual blockchain settlement may happen later when users deposit or withdraw their assets.
What Is an Exchange’s Internal Ledger?
A centralized exchange generally maintains an internal database that tracks customer balances.
For example, after depositing 1 BTC, your account might display:
BTC Balance: 1.000000 BTC
If you then sell 0.2 BTC for USDT, the exchange can update your internal balances:
BTC: 0.800000
USDT: + the proceeds from the sale
The exchange doesn’t necessarily need to broadcast a new Bitcoin transaction every time two users trade.
This allows centralized exchanges to process many trades quickly.
However, it also means users are trusting the exchange to maintain accurate records and honor withdrawals.
Why Don’t All Exchange Trades Appear on the Blockchain?
Blockchain networks can be slower and more expensive than centralized databases.
Imagine millions of trades happening every day.
Recording every internal exchange trade directly on a blockchain could create unnecessary costs and congestion.
Therefore, centralized exchanges typically handle trades internally.
The blockchain becomes especially important when assets enter or leave the platform.
For example:
Your wallet → Exchange
This is generally an on-chain transaction.
But:
Your exchange account → Another exchange user’s account
may simply be an internal database update.
This is one of the major differences between centralized and decentralized trading.
What Happens When You Deposit Crypto?
Let’s say you want to deposit Bitcoin into a centralized exchange.
The process generally looks like this:
Step 1: Generate a Deposit Address
The exchange gives you a Bitcoin deposit address.
Step 2: Send Bitcoin
You send BTC from your personal wallet to that address.
Step 3: The Transaction Enters the Network
Your transaction is broadcast to the Bitcoin network.
Step 4: Miners Confirm the Transaction
Bitcoin miners include the transaction in a block.
Step 5: The Exchange Detects the Deposit
The exchange monitors the blockchain and identifies the incoming transaction.
Step 6: Your Balance Is Credited
After the exchange’s required confirmations, your account receives the deposited balance.
The exact number of confirmations can vary.
What Happens When You Withdraw Crypto?
Withdrawals work in the opposite direction.
Suppose you have Bitcoin on an exchange and want to move it to your own wallet.
You provide:
- Your Bitcoin address.
- The amount you want to withdraw.
- Any required security confirmations.
The exchange then creates and broadcasts a Bitcoin transaction.
Once the network confirms it, the funds appear in your wallet.
The exchange may charge a withdrawal fee.
This fee can depend on the asset, network conditions, and the exchange’s own policies.
Why Can Exchange Withdrawals Be Delayed?
A cryptocurrency withdrawal isn’t always instant.
Possible reasons include:
- Blockchain congestion.
- Security checks.
- Internal exchange processing.
- Maintenance.
- Withdrawal limits.
- Compliance requirements.
- Network problems.
If a withdrawal is marked as “pending,” it doesn’t necessarily mean that the blockchain itself is having a problem.
Sometimes the exchange hasn’t broadcast the transaction yet.
What Is a Decentralized Exchange Actually Doing?
A DEX works differently.
Instead of maintaining a traditional customer account and internal balance system, the DEX uses smart contracts deployed on a blockchain.
You connect your wallet.
You select the assets you want to trade.
The smart contract processes the swap.
The resulting assets are sent to your wallet according to the protocol’s rules.
The transaction is recorded on the blockchain.
This means the process is more transparent, but it also requires users to understand blockchain transactions.
How Does a DEX Determine the Price?
Many DEXs use automated market makers (AMMs).
Instead of relying on a traditional order book, an AMM uses liquidity pools.
A pool might contain:
ETH + USDC
Traders swap against the pool.
When someone buys ETH using USDC, the pool’s balance changes.
The pricing algorithm then adjusts the exchange rate.
The exact formula depends on the protocol.
This system allows trades to happen automatically without requiring a specific buyer and seller to match.
What Is Price Impact?
Price impact refers to how much your own trade changes the price because of the amount of liquidity available.
Suppose a DEX pool has $10 million in liquidity.
A $100 trade may have almost no noticeable impact.
Now imagine a trader attempts a $5 million trade against the same pool.
The trade could significantly change the balance of the pool.
As a result, the trader may receive a less favorable average price.
Therefore, larger trades require greater attention to liquidity and price impact.
What Is Slippage Tolerance?
When trading on a DEX, you may be asked to set a slippage tolerance.
This determines how much the price can move before the transaction fails.
For example, if you set a 0.5% slippage tolerance, you’re generally allowing the trade to execute within that specified range.
If the market moves beyond the allowed amount, the transaction may fail.
A very low tolerance can cause legitimate trades to fail.
A very high tolerance can expose you to an unexpectedly poor execution price.
Therefore, users should understand the setting before changing it.
What Are DEX Trading Fees?
DEX transactions can involve several types of costs.
These may include:
- Network gas fees.
- Trading fees.
- Protocol fees.
- Token approval transactions.
The exact costs depend on the blockchain and DEX.
For example, trading on Ethereum may require ETH for gas.
A user may therefore pay a network fee even if the DEX itself charges a separate trading fee.
Why Can DEX Trades Require Multiple Transactions?
Some token swaps require an approval transaction before the actual swap.
For example:
Transaction 1: Approve the smart contract to use your token.
Transaction 2: Execute the swap.
Each blockchain transaction can require a network fee.
After you have already approved a token for a particular contract, future transactions may not always require another approval, depending on the allowance and protocol.
This is why a beginner may sometimes see two wallet confirmations instead of one.
What Is an AMM Liquidity Pool?
A liquidity pool is a collection of assets locked in smart contracts.
Liquidity providers deposit assets into the pool.
Traders then use the pool to exchange tokens.
For example:
ETH/USDC Pool
could contain both ETH and USDC.
A trader selling ETH adds ETH to the pool and removes USDC.
Another trader may perform the opposite trade.
The pool’s balances continuously change as trading occurs.
How Do Liquidity Providers Make Money?
Liquidity providers can receive a portion of the trading fees generated by their pool.
For example, imagine thousands of trades occur through a pool.
Each trade pays a small fee.
A portion of those fees may be distributed to liquidity providers.
However, the return isn’t guaranteed.
Liquidity providers can face:
- Impermanent loss.
- Token price declines.
- Smart-contract risk.
- Low trading volume.
- Protocol changes.
Therefore, the advertised fee rate shouldn’t be treated as guaranteed profit.
What Is a Liquidity Pool Token?
Some DeFi protocols issue a token or accounting representation that represents a user’s share of a liquidity pool.
For example, if you deposit assets into a pool, the protocol may give you a token representing your position.
That token can sometimes be used elsewhere in the DeFi ecosystem.
This is one example of DeFi’s composability.
However, not every liquidity pool uses the same mechanism.

Which Is More Private?
Privacy depends on the platform and jurisdiction.
Centralized exchanges often collect identity information because they may have Know Your Customer (KYC) and anti-money-laundering requirements.
A DEX generally allows users to interact through blockchain addresses rather than traditional accounts.
However, blockchain transactions are usually public.
A blockchain address may not directly display your name, but transactions associated with that address can often be analyzed.
Therefore, “no account” does not automatically mean “completely anonymous.”
What Is KYC?
KYC means Know Your Customer.
It refers to identity-verification procedures used by many financial services.
A centralized exchange may ask for information such as:
- Full name.
- Date of birth.
- Government-issued identification.
- Address.
- Other verification information.
The exact requirements vary by platform and country.
KYC can help exchanges comply with financial regulations, but it also means users provide personal information to a centralized organization.
What Is Two-Factor Authentication?
Two-factor authentication, commonly called 2FA, adds another security layer to an account.
Instead of relying only on a password, the exchange may require another verification method.
Examples include:
- Authenticator applications.
- Security keys.
- One-time codes.
2FA can reduce the risk of account takeover if someone obtains your password.
However, not all 2FA methods offer the same level of protection.
What Is a Crypto Exchange API?
Some exchanges provide APIs that allow software applications to interact with their trading systems.
An API can allow approved applications to:
- Read market prices.
- Monitor balances.
- Submit trades.
- Retrieve order information.
Professional traders and automated trading systems often use exchange APIs.
API keys must be handled carefully.
Never give unrestricted API access to an unknown application.
What Is an Exchange Reserve?
An exchange reserve refers broadly to cryptocurrency held by an exchange.
Users sometimes monitor exchange reserves to understand how much cryptocurrency platforms hold.
Proof-of-reserves systems can provide additional information about an exchange’s assets.
However, reserves alone don’t necessarily provide a complete picture of a company’s financial health.
Liabilities, legal structures, off-chain assets, and other factors can also matter.
Therefore, users should avoid treating a reserve figure as a complete guarantee of solvency.

What Happens If a Crypto Exchange Gets Hacked?
The consequences depend on the type and severity of the incident.
An exchange might temporarily:
- Freeze withdrawals.
- Investigate the incident.
- Move funds between wallets.
- Contact security teams.
- Notify customers.
In serious cases, users could lose access to some or all of their assets.
This is one reason why cryptocurrency custody matters.
Holding assets on an exchange means you’re trusting that platform to protect them.
Self-custody removes some forms of exchange risk but introduces personal security responsibilities.
Is a DEX Safer Than a CEX?
Not necessarily.
A DEX removes certain centralized risks.
For example, you generally don’t need to give custody of your funds to a company for a normal wallet-based swap.
However, DEX users face other risks.
These include:
- Smart-contract exploits.
- Malicious tokens.
- Fake websites.
- Phishing.
- High slippage.
- MEV-related trading risks.
- Wallet compromises.
Therefore, decentralized does not automatically mean safe.
The risks are simply different.
What Is MEV?
MEV stands for Maximal Extractable Value.
It refers to the value that can potentially be extracted from the ordering or inclusion of transactions in a blockchain.
In decentralized trading, certain market participants or automated systems may attempt to profit from transaction ordering.
MEV can contribute to problems such as:
- Front-running.
- Sandwich attacks.
- Poorer trade execution.
The exact mechanics depend on the blockchain and trading environment.
Users don’t need to understand every technical detail to start using a DEX, but they should know that the price shown before a transaction isn’t always the final price they receive.
